5. Challenges and Drawbacks:
While online poker brings many advantages, it is really not without its challenges. One of several significant downsides may be the possibility deceptive tasks, including collusion and processor chip dumping, where people cheat to achieve an unfair advantage. However, reputable on-line poker systems use robust security steps and random quantity generators to thwart such behavior. In addition, some people might find the lack of actual cues and interactions which can be section of live poker games a disadvantage, as possible more difficult to learn opponents and employ mental techniques on line.
